I'm a Principal Product Manager working on recommender systems and new forms of interaction with media. At Spotify, my work focuses on how people discover, explore, and interact with music and other content — from search and recommendation to interactive and conversational experiences.
My background is in recommender systems, and I've stayed closely connected to the research community throughout my career. My recent research has focused on search and discovery at Spotify, including exploratory search and using language models to improve the retrieval of content that is otherwise difficult to find. I'm particularly interested in the space between research and product: taking ideas from recommender systems, information retrieval, and human-computer interaction and turning them into experiences used at scale.
Outside of my day-to-day work, I'm an active volunteer in the ACM RecSys community. I've served in a range of roles over the years, including General Chair of RecSys 2021, and I currently serve on the Executive Committee of the ACM RecSys Steering Committee.
